ROCHESTER, N.Y. - The Bard College women's volleyball team was swept twice on Saturday at a Liberty League Crossover hosted by Rochester Institute of Technology.
RIT swept Bard 25-19, 25-12 and 26-24. Later, St. Lawrence defeated Bard 25-22, 25-8 and 25-20.
In the first match, RIT hit .329 and held off Bard for the sweep. In the first set, the Raptors trailed 5-1 early but eventually tied it, 12-12. The Tigers scored the next three points and Bard didn't get closer than two the rest of the way.
In the second set Bard got down 10-5 and just never made it back. And in the third set, the Raptors had leads of 12-8, 17-14 and 24-22, but RIT rallied to pull it out.
For the winners, Sara Taylor (Tonawanda, NY) had 11 kills and hit .450, and Sarah Szybist (Colorado Springs, CO) had 10 kills and hit .600. For Bard, Sophia Koukia,
Alexis Akingbade and
Kaylynn Tran had five kills apiece;
Victoria Chou added eight assists and seven digs.
Against St. Lawrence, the first and third sets were close, but Bard just couldn't get over the hump. Grace Kelly (West Chazy, NY) had 14 kills and hit .480.
Philippine Alba led Bard with eight kills; Chou had 18 assists, and
Emily Anastasi led the Raptors with 10 digs.
Bard is 2-10, 0-4 in the Liberty League; St. Lawrence is 5-8, 1-3; and RIT is 9-4, 3-1.
